Blimey, this is an old thread revived!

Welcome along Heather!

You may have gained weight eating pasta/rice before SW but you wouldn't have been restricting your bread/cereal/cheese/milk/fatty food/sweet foods like you do on SW.

SW works because certain foods are free but others, like bread, are restricted.

It may be that red days will work better for you in that case?
To be honest, people find that it isn't things like pasta, rice and bread that made them put on weight, its the other things they "forget" about! ( i know that was my problem!) as well as things you put on or in the pasta.. its amazing how bad some of the sauces are for you!

If you look on the Slimming World website theres an interesting bit about how it works. The theory is that carbs are supposed to fill you up and therefore you will have less room to snack!

it is strange how it works but its to do with the way your body uses what it's putting in to you.
